Innovative company since 2011: Specialist in LED-based solar simulators

Since 2011, the company has been successfully developing solar simulators. Starting with an innovative idea, the company has specialized in the production of solar simulators based on LED technology. These enable precise measurements of solar cells and solar modules, whereby the spectrum can be flexibly adjusted. A particular advantage of this technology is the low maintenance, which ensures long-term cost efficiency.

High precision and reliability: LED technology for the solar industry

The company primarily serves customers in research and development and in production who require the highest precision in their measurements. By using LED technology, the company achieves exceptional spectral homogeneity that closely matches the natural solar spectrum. This makes it possible to accurately determine the power of solar modules under standard conditions, which is of great importance in the solar industry.

High-end solutions and future visions in solar measurement technology

The company offers high-end solutions with integrated spectrometers that ensure measurements are precise and reliable. In addition to light measurement and spectral tracking, the company also offers an electroluminescence camera that can be used to detect and sort out defects in solar modules. This advanced technology is offered by only a few companies worldwide and represents an important step in the further development of solar measurement technology.
